Anther
The part of a flower's stamen that contains the pollen, key in the reproductive process of plants.
Generative Cell
In the development of pollen grains, the cell that divides to form the sperm cells necessary forplant fertilization.
Sepals
The part of a flower that typically acts as a protective covering for the flower in bud form and supports the petals once they bloom.
Outermost Whorl
The outermost circle or arrangement of parts in a flower, typically consisting of sepals.
